Transaction 843e36a361eca067df569e6a91905e4ea9328207894ccc9ff78184be71344695
3 Input
2 Outputs
- 843e36a361eca067df569e6a91905e4ea9328207894ccc9ff78184be71344695:0
- 843e36a361eca067df569e6a91905e4ea9328207894ccc9ff78184be71344695:1
value 726
address 17CS9JJ5KK9PbEhAZW2WoXzbhX8w8nHQoz
value 886195
address 1LYgfoeBKyB1AXh97pqUp5W4m1dDQJJr1w